Common Misconceptions
One common misconception about Mathematica is that it is exclusively for experienced users. While it is true that experienced users can leverage its full extent, the intuitive interface and extensive documentation make it accessible to users of all backgrounds. Another misconception is that Mathematica is only for mathematical and scientific applications; in reality, its applications are diverse and include fields such as finance, engineering, and social sciences.

Mathematica is a computational software system that uses a powerful programming language to automate complex mathematical and scientific tasks. It is particularly effective in creating interactive visualizations, allowing users to manipulate and explore data in various ways. Mathematica's core functionality is based on the Wolfram Language, a high-level language that enables users to create complex data structures and algorithms. With a user-friendly interface and extensive libraries, Mathematica makes it possible for users to tackle even the most intricate problems with relative ease.

The opportunities afforded by Mathematica's powerful graphing and visualization capabilities are numerous. For instance, it enables researchers to explore complex datasets, scientists to model phenomena, and professionals to develop innovative solutions. However, like any complex tool, Mathematica requires a learning curve, and users may encounter steep challenges in using its advanced features.
